Ranji Trophy: Spirited J&K outplays Odhisa to gain top spot in Group C

A spirited display of cricket on Tuesday guided J&K to a comprehensive win against Odhisa in the ongoing Ranji Trophy at Cuttack.

With six points from this match, the Parvez Rasool-led side has now gained the top spot in the Group C points table with 32 points in 6 matches.

Earlier, after restricting the home team to a below-par total in the first innings, J&K found themselves in trouble as batsmen failed to resist at the tricky track of Cuttack.

However, Umar Nazir was wrecker-in-chief in second innings, bagging five wickets to ensure visitors get a reasonable target to chase.

The rest of the job was done by young Suryansh Raina, who scored a gutsy half century while lastly, Auqib Nabi and Abdul Samad helped J&K cross the line with four wickets in hand.

In first innings, Auqib Nabi was the star performer as he scalped a fifer apart from contributing valuable runs.
